视觉检测中的伪影处理:从原理到实践的终极指南 | 迁移科技

admin 3 2026-02-18 09:10:27 编辑

什么是视觉检测中的伪影处理?

视觉检测中的伪影处理,是指在通过机器视觉系统进行检测、测量或引导时,识别并消除因光照变化、物体表面高反光/纯黑、相机自身噪声等物理或电子因素,在图像中产生的虚假、失真或干扰信号,以确保算法能够准确提取目标特征的关键技术步骤。

在自动化产线中,伪影是导致系统误判、漏检的罪魁祸首,直接影响生产效率与产品质量。因此,高效的伪影处理能力是衡量一套视觉系统是否稳定可靠的核心指标。

伪影处理的核心价值:不止于让图像“好看”

强大的伪影处理技术,能为工业自动化带来决定性的优势。正如一位资深机器视觉工程师所评价:“迁移科技解决了工业现场最头疼的‘光’和‘黑’两个物理难题,让机器视觉真正具备了全天候工作能力。”这背后就是卓越的伪影处理技术在支撑。

  • 提升检测准确率:有效区分真实缺陷与光照伪影,大幅降低误报率和漏报率,是实现精密质检的基础。
  • 扩展应用边界:使视觉系统能够处理高反光金属、透明玻璃、吸光黑色塑料等传统视觉难以应对的“魔鬼”材料。
  • 保障系统稳定性:在3D视觉引导领域,高效的伪影处理是实现高精度抓取的基石。行业数据显示,相比传统2D视觉,3D视觉引导能解决95%以上的无序堆叠抓取难题,而这背后离不开对复杂光影下点云数据伪影的精准处理。

伪影处理的工作流程与先进技术

一个完整的伪影处理流程通常结合了硬件优化与软件算法。在处理复杂环节时,行业先进方案(如迁移科技的结构光成像 (Structured Light)激光机械振镜技术点云处理与6D位姿估计抗反光成像算法)通常采用系统性的方法来解决。

  1. 步骤1:光学系统优化(硬件预防)。通过选择合适的光源(如偏振光、漫反射穹顶光源)和高动态范围(HDR)相机,在成像源头抑制伪影的产生。
  2. 步骤2:图像预处理(软件校正)。应用滤波算法(如高斯滤波、中值滤波)平滑噪声,通过形态学操作(腐蚀、膨胀)消除孤立的亮点或暗点。
  3. 步骤3:高级算法处理(智能剔除)。在3D视觉中,迁移科技的抗反光成像算法能在生成点云时就智能滤除由反光引起的无效数据点。结合深度学习模型,系统甚至能学习并识别特定场景下的复杂伪影模式,实现更精准的剔除。
  4. 步骤4:数据重建与验证。处理伪影后,通过算法对信息进行插值或重建,最终输出一个干净、准确的目标模型用于后续的测量或抓取,例如通过点云处理与6D位姿估计算法获得精确的物体位置。

伪影处理的关键应用场景

3D机器视觉 / 光学测量 / 机器人引导领域,伪影处理是实现高精度作业的必要条件。

  • 机器人无序抓取在分拣反光的金属零件时,必须滤除镜面反射产生的虚假点云,否则机器人将无法计算正确的抓取姿态。

  • 高精度光学测量:测量手机中框、曲面玻璃等高反光部件的尺寸时,消除高光和阴影伪影是保证微米级测量精度的前提。

  • 表面缺陷检测:检测汽车漆面或电池盖板的细微划痕时,需要将划痕与普通的光斑伪影清晰地区分开来。

常见问题 (FAQ)

伪影处理是靠硬件还是软件?

最佳方案是软硬结合。硬件(如光源、相机)负责从源头预防和减少伪影的产生,软件算法则负责对已生成的伪影进行识别、校正和剔除,两者互为补充。

深度学习在伪影处理中扮演什么角色?

深度学习能够学习和识别传统算法难以用规则定义的复杂伪影,尤其对于材质多变、光照环境复杂的场景,其效果远超传统图像处理方法,鲁棒性更强。

如何评估一套视觉系统的伪影处理能力?

关键是看其在极限工况下的表现。例如,能否稳定处理高反光和纯黑物体,以及在高速运动中是否能抑制运动模糊。选择具备高并发下的系统稳定性达到行业领先水平的服务商,如迁移科技,是重要的参考标准。

总结与建议

视觉检测中的伪影处理并非简单的“图像美化”,而是决定自动化系统成败的底层核心技术。它直接关系到检测的准确性、测量的精度和机器人引导的稳定性。对于希望提升产线智能化水平的企业而言,选择一个在光学、算法层面都具备深度伪影处理能力的技术伙伴至关重要。建议在评估方案时,优先考虑如迁移科技这样拥有核心算法和丰富落地经验的专业团队。

视觉检测中的伪影处理:从原理到实践的终极指南 | 迁移科技

上一篇: 工业相机,为什么选择它们以及如何使用
相关文章